Motorola Solutions signs up with Arya Omnitalk to promote professional and commercial radios

Bengaluru, 16th April 2024: Pune-headquartered Arya Omnitalk, a joint venture between two of India’s most reputed business houses, Arvind Ltd. and the JM Baxi Group, has secured an exclusive partnership with Motorola Solutions to distribute Professional and Commercial Radios in India.

Arya Omnitalk operates three business divisions, namely Shared Mobile Radio Services (SMR), GPS-based Fleet Tracking and Management Solutions, and Toll and Highway Traffic Management Systems (HTMS). Under this collaboration, Arya Omnitalk will exclusively distribute Motorola Solutions’ MOTOTRBO Portfolio of products, along with continuing to distribute Wave PTX and associated services.

A leading provider of PMRTS (Public Mobile Radio Trunking Services), CMRTS (Captive Mobile Radio Trunking Services), and Broadband Push-to-talk devices, Arya Omnitalk holds licenses to operate in 18 cities including Ahmedabad, Bengaluru, Chennai, Delhi, Indore, Kolkata, Bharuch, Navi Mumbai, Gurgaon, Noida, Mumbai, Pune, Surat, Vadodara, Visakhapatnam, Hyderabad, Kochi, and Jaipur.

YES BANK and CNBC-TV18 partner to propel India’s economic ascent at Ahmedabad edition of The Growth Summit

February 23rd, 2024: The second edition of YES BANK and CNBC-TV18’s – The Growth Summit: A vision to a $10 Trillion Economy, in association with Max Life Insurance, was held in Ahmedabad, Gujarat. The event convened policymakers, industry leaders, startup founders, innovators, and academic experts to deliberate on crucial factors essential for India’s economic progress. Central to the Summit’s discussions was the government’s ambitious 25-year plan aimed at positioning India as the world’s third-largest economy with a GDP of $10 trillion.

In his opening remarks at the Summit, Mr. Prashant Kumar, Managing Director & CEO, YES BANK said, “Gujarat emerges as the cornerstone of India’s economic ascent, contributing a staggering 33% to the nation’s exports in FY 2022-23. With ambitions to reach a $1 trillion economy by 2030, Gujarat’s leadership extends beyond traditional sectors, fostering a thriving ecosystem for innovation and infrastructure development. As the world’s largest diamond hub in Surat and the birthplace of India’s first operational greenfield Smart City, Gujarat positions itself as the beacon of opportunity. The state is poised to absorb the influx of businesses seeking alternatives to China, catalysing India’s journey towards economic supremacy.”

During his address, Mr. Kumar announced the launch of ‘Yes Private’ in Ahmedabad, which is the Bank’s newest market offering that aims to partner HNI Business owners and C-Suite executives in their endeavour to leverage the opportunities on the road towards a $10 trillion Indian economy.

The event progressed with an engaging conversation on ‘India’s Role as A Global Hub of Growth’ featuring Mr. Jayen Mehta, MD, AMUL (GCMMF), where he said, “Agriculture is the base of our economy. However, in terms of numbers, still agriculture contribution is less than 20%. Hence, we need to support agriculture and farmers, while also working on doubling their income which is also the professor policy of the government. These efforts will help in supporting the number of people associated with agriculture which is more than 60-70% of the population. The country still depends on agriculture as part of its primary income. So this is where a combination of policies which are pro farmer, pro-development and pro market is the way forward for our country. So if you can build a bridge and if only 20% of us convert our regular food into organic food, the GDP from agriculture will rise. These are very, very small and objective steps one has to take and organisations like ours are working towards the same using the cooperative model and building the country.”

Shark Tank featured founders Adil Qadri and Ananya Maloo from Gujarat to meet startup founders

shark tank featured founders

Ahmedabad, 7 February 2024: Popular business reality show Shark Tank featured founders from Gujarat, Adil Qadri, founder of Adil Qadri – House of Premium Fragrances and Ananya Maloo, Co-Founder of Nuutjob will meet dozens of startup founders from the state to share strategies around brand development, scalability, and marketing insights at D2C Unlocked in Ahmedabad, organised by Checkout Network Simpl. Titled ‘Aapnu Amdavad’, the event will witness a panel discussion followed by a networking event where startups can engage with the Shark Tank featured founders and other panelists and gain rich insights about their entrepreneurial journey.

The two founders will also share their experiences from the popular business reality show Shark Tank and how startups can aspire to participate in such events to boost their brand. While Adil Qadri secured a Rs 1 crore investment from Sugar Cosmetics CEO Vineeta Singh, Nuutjob co-founder Ananya Maloo, a male intimate hygiene and grooming brand, raised a total of Rs 25 lakhs from Lenskart founder Piyush Bansal, Emcure Pharmaceuticals Executive Director Namita Thapar and Boat founder Aman Gupta.

Joining them will be Jigar Patel, Co-Founder and CEO of Brillare Science, and Tanisha Lakhani, Founder, and CEO of Protouch. The panel will delve into topics such as innovative marketing strategies, overcoming challenges in product development, and the evolving trends shaping the D2C sector.

Gujarat is one of the fastest-growing startup ecosystems in the country and has assisted more than 12,900 startups and supported more than 180 incubators across the state with financial support of more than Rs 210 core. It has also established more than 100 Patent Information centers in various academic institutions and more than 900 patents have been filed with support from State Government.
